What type of force does the wheel reduce?
A wheel reduces friction by allowing the contacting surfaces to roll rather than to drag or slide over each other. When wheels are used, rolling friction starts acting instead of kinetic friction. Thus the frictional force acting on the wheel would be less. Therefore, because of less friction, to travel freely, wheels are used.
